McDonald’s Sues Former CEO to Recoup Millions in Severance Alleging of Improper Employee Relationships
McDonald’s Corporation (McDonald’s) sued its former Chief Executive Officer, Steve Easterbrook, in August 2020 in an effort to force him to repay the $40 million in severance and equity awards provided to him when the company terminated his employment....
